Output 376911011f29f7e079476faad8715a85131d117837235a49cd226d2c8ed2b108:4

value
50384377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5aeff3792c4c1fbb06fa1da9fcd1f5f61dfd98 OP_EQUAL
address
MRLxEWEMhrmiFpnEyfF9EDuQ7zSqMBktJB
transaction
376911011f29f7e079476faad8715a85131d117837235a49cd226d2c8ed2b108
spent
true